Return to shooting mode. 4 Start recording. Camera will take pictures at specified interval until shut- ter-release button is pressed again, memory card is full, or 1,800 pictures have been taken. Take a Test Shot Take a test shot and view the results before beginning recording. Use a Reliable Power Source To prevent shooting from ending unexpectedly, use the optional EH-54 AC adapter for interval timer photography. During Recording To save power, the monitor and electronic viewfinder turn off between pictures. The display turns on automatically immediately before the camera takes the next shot. Folders Each sequence of pictures is stored in a folder with a name consisting of a three-digit folder number followed by "INTVL" (e.g., "101INTVL").
